It’s a reunion for Gulzar and KK, all thanks to Srijit’s next film

Srijit Mukherji is super happy to collaborate with not only noted lyricist Gulzar but also playback singer KK for his upcoming film ‘Sherdil’. The film, according to reports, revolves around a real life incident that happened in the Pilibhit Tiger Reserve, where villagers used to leave the elderly people, mostly from their families, for tigers to prey on, because they used to claim compensation from the administration for the deaths. The alarming rate of tiger attacks on these senior people soon creates confusion and makes the forest authorities suspicious about the exact happenings. ‘Sherdil’ has powerhouse actor Pankaj Tripathi essaying the role of a village head, who needs help from the dense cover of the jungle in order to protect his poor family. Taking to Twitter, director Mukherji had earlier shared his excitement about joining hands with his all-time-favourite KK, who has lent his voice for a song penned by Gulzar in ‘Sherdil’. "Finally got to work with a favourite for years - KK!! #Sherdil #SongRecording," the National Award winner, best known for films like ‘Jaatishwar’, ‘Gumnaami’, and ‘Dwitiyo Purush’ among others, penned. Incidentally, KK had started his film playback journey with Gulzar when he sang the famous song 'Chhod Aaye Hum Woh Galiyaan' composed by Vishal Bhardwaj for the 1996 hit "Maachis", also directed by Gulzar. The singer-lyricist pair since then has collaborated for many films including 2001's ‘Aks’, 2002's ‘Filhaal..’ and ‘Saathiya’, and ‘Jhoom Barabar Jhoom’ in 2007, to name a few. ‘Sherdil’ also stars Neeraj Kabi and Sayani Gupta in key roles.
